Common Cause Georgia works to defend and strengthen democracy by advocating for free, fair, and accessible elections across the state. In 2026, our work is focused on building a powerful network of activists ready to push back on authoritarianism and fight for government accountability and transparency.

We working to:

-Protect voting access: Opposing major anti-voter legislation, including measures like the SAVE Act at the Federal level and all state level anti-voter legislation. Including election protection, our monitoring work of the State Election Board, and monitoring county election boards across the state.

-Strengthen coalitions: Partnering with grassroots organizations across the state to build collective power and coordinate advocacy efforts.

-Civic engagement & education: Building community, training and equipping people and community members with the tools to advocate, monitor elections, and take action on key democracy issues.

Through this work, Common Cause Georgia is building a more inclusive, participatory democracy centering the voices of communities most impacted and preparing for critical elections ahead.

The 2017 Georgia Anti-Gerrymandering Tour

The 2017 Georgia Anti-Gerrymandering Tour

In 2017- 2018 Common Cause Georgia and dedicated partners toured the state discussing the effects of gerrymandering on the redistricting process.
